FatPipe Networks: FatPipe Awarded a $7 Million Education Contract to Support Network Access and Monitoring
FatPipe Inc. (NASDAQ:FATN) said it was awarded a $7 million education contract to supply its network edge products and monitoring services for schools. The deployment aims to improve network availability and visibility, helping administrators monitor health, troubleshoot connectivity issues, and restore access faster for learning and administrative systems.
